Perform a Command-Line Installation in Windows:
You can install Converter Standalone from the MS-DOS Command prompt or by writing a Windows batch file (.bat) to automate the installation process.

Prerequisites
You must have Administrator privileges.

Procedure
* At the command line, install Converter Standalone silently with the log file written to the temp directory.
VMware-converter-<build>.exe /s /v"/qn ADDLOCAL=ALL /l*v %TEMP%\vmconvservermsi.log"

Option Action
/s Does not display the Windows Installer version check.
/v"<params> Passes parameters to the msiexec.exe file
/qn Runs the msi command in silent mode.
/qb Runs the msi command in basic mode.
/qf Runs the msi command in full mode.
/l*v <Logfile> Record login information in the file provided in <Logfile>.
/x Uninstall VMware vCenter Converter Standalone.
ADDLOCAL="ALL" Installs full package. Parameter is case-sensitive.
PROPERTY=<property value> Sets the value of a property to <property value>.
VMCE_HTTP_PORT Sets the HTTP port. The default is 80. Remote machines connect to the server through this port to download the Converter Standalone client.
VMCE_HTTPS_PORT Set the HTTPS port. The default is 443. Remote Converter Standalone clients connect to this port on the server and submit conversion tasks.
VMCE_AGENT_PORT Sets an Agent port. The default is 9089. Remote Converter Standalone agents connect to this port to convert this machine.
